ChampionX has future and immediate hiring needs for experienced I&E Technicians in Freeport, TX to support our operations team.


Accountability Objective

The I & E Technician is responsible for safe and efficient maintenance and calibration of facility process instrumentation and electrical components.


Position Qualifications

The position requires knowledge of maintenance procedures and ability to troubleshoot, repairs, and calibrate plant instrumentation. An associate’s degree in a related area and 7+ years related experience is preferred. The position also requires a valid electrician’s license issued by the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ation (TDLR).


What You Will Do (Principal Accountabilities)

- Able to read and correct the following drawings:

- Piping and Instrument Drawings (P&ID)

- Electrical Drawings

- Instrument Loop Drawings

- Schematics

- Proficient with Delta-V

- Proficient with Micro Motion flow meters

- Familiar with low/high voltage electrical work (120v, 208v, 220v, 277v, 240v, 480v, 2400v, and 12/4/7 incoming power)

- Perform planned maintenance checks and calibrations in a timely manner and submit appropriate reports

- Troubleshoots, repairs, and calibrates all plant instrumentation and electrical equipment as necessary

- Troubleshooting consists of learning operational procedures and theory to make intelligent decisions in pinpointing problems regardless of whether it pertains to equipment failure, procedure or process problems. One should be able to give appropriate suggestions or make the accurate corrections required in solving the problem

- Repair consists of making sure inventory is kept either by setting up the appropriate equipment in the warehouse or purchasing the related equipment/part when needed. The mechanic needs to determine if the equipment is in a serviceable condition

- Calibration consists of using the system in place to correctly calibrate that equipment, keep the appropriate records and to adjust, if necessary, the steps needed to prolong the life and usefulness of that equipment

- Able to install, repair, and complete revisions to plant instrumentation and electrical equipment while following drawings and making “As Built” corrections or drawings as needed

- Minimize downtime and unsafe conditions by performing preventative and corrective maintenance on various types of equipment to ensure safe and efficient operations

- After being trained in the use of the DocuMint Database and Calibrations, will use them for scheduling, calibration, and documentation of plant instrumentation (Loveland)

- Maintains the instrumentation and electrical spare parts inventory

- With assistance from Engineering, develops and executes an effective preventive maintenance program for all equipment and preventive calibration program for all critical instrumentation

- Arranges for and coordinates the efficient and economical installation of replacement and/or new equipment and systems throughout the facility. Calculates and provides estimates for maintenance and construction jobs to ensure economical and efficient work

- Provides technical assistance to contract personnel engaged in electrical and instrumentation as requested by Reliability Team Leader

- Participate in rotating call out schedule and respond to emergency calls as needed

- Participate in PHA, engineering design meetings, audits, root cause analysis meetings, etc.

- Use SAP to review and close out Work Orders (Corrective and Preventive)

- Perform all other duties as assigned

- Performs all work while emphasizing safety and maintaining a clean, safe, and environmentally compliant work area

- Supports and incorporates the activities of Continuous Improvement (CI) into ongoing work duties through teamwork within and across departments. Use CI to eliminate losses and waste that hamper facility effectiveness so that safety is advanced, process and equipment are reliable, quality is stabilized/improved, and reduce operating costs

- Identify electrical hazards, establish shock and arc flash boundaries, and follow NFPA 70E electrical safe work practices, including lockout/tagout, justification approvals for energized work, and required personal protective equipment (PPE)


Additional Responsibilities / Deliverables

Management of SIS / Critical Protection Devices

- Support inspection, testing, and maintenance of Safety Instrumented Systems (SIS), interlocks, alarms, and safety shutdown devices in accordance with site procedures and applicable standards


Alarm & Control Performance Support

- Assist Operations and Engineering in identifying poor-performing instruments, nuisance alarms, or control valves that negatively impact unit stability and uptime


MOC & Change Management Support

- Support Management of Change (MOC) activities by reviewing instrumentation and electrical impacts, updating documentation, and verifying field installation compliance


Bad Actor & Reliability Input

- Provide technical input to reliability reviews, bad actor identification, and root cause analysis by identifying recurring instrumentation and electrical failures


Standardization & Best Practices

- Support standardization of instrumentation, electrical components, and calibration practices to reduce variation, spare parts complexity, and maintenance errors


Data Quality Ownership

- Ensure calibration records, loop documentation, and SAP notifications accurately reflect actual field conditions and equipment status


Mentoring / Skill Development

- Assist in mentoring junior technicians or contractors by reinforcing safe work practices, troubleshooting methods, and site standards
